materialkoppelung
Materialkoppelung refers to the phenomenon where the properties or behavior of one material are influenced by the presence or interaction of another material. This coupling can occur through various mechanisms, including physical contact, chemical bonding, or electromagnetic fields. In essence, it describes how materials do not always act in isolation but can exhibit combined or altered characteristics when brought together.
